Medical Exams
In many car accident attorney accident cases the insurance company of the party at fault will require you to undergo an independent medical exam. It can be a No-Fault IME or an Liability IME. The insurance company will typically request that you undergo an independent medical examination to determine if they have any information that could be used to end your No-Fault benefits or to dispute your claim.
The IME is an examination carried out by a doctor who isn't familiar with you and has never had a chance to treat you before. It is designed to verify the severity of your injuries and the treatment you have received in the past. Additionally, it will provide a thorough report on your health.
An IME is only necessary in cases where you've suffered an injury that is serious and cannot be verified by your own medical records, and it is generally used in cases of broken bones. It's sometimes required for injuries that take time to heal, including back pain or neck strains.
There is no way to stop the IME from occurring, but you can take steps to ensure that it is as fair as possible. For example, you can ask your Queens personal injury lawyer if you can keep a record of the IME, which will ensure that the doctor isn't telling you things that are not documented in your medical records.
While you should be pleasant and cooperative during the IME you must also be honest about your injuries and the circumstances surrounding the accident. The examining doctor will ask about any injuries or other conditions that occurred prior to the accident. They will also ask if your lifestyle choices have contributed to your current injury.
These questions are vital and you must be prepared. For instance, you could have to say that you have a specific knee issue that was caused by the crash and has not improved since.
It may be necessary to mention that you experience trouble standing or walking for longer than a few minutes. These are important factors in determining your physical limitations.
Determining Liability
If you're involved in an all-car pileup or fender bender, determining whether you're liable under the car accident law is essential for obtaining the full amount of compensation. The process of determining fault is a complicated high-risk process that could leave you feeling a bit shaken and overwhelmed.
Depending on the state, fault can be determined by looking at the facts of the incident and determining who is in violation of motor vehicle laws. Most of the time, if a driver was reckless or disregarding the safety of others, they could be considered negligent for the accident.
Sometimes, an accident can be caused by a poorly maintained or constructed road. If this is the case, you can seek legal action against the responsible government agency.
Insurance companies will look over the police report, as well as other evidence from the crash to determine if they are responsible. They will also conduct interviews with witnesses to gather their details.
If the accident was caused by a negligent driver, they could be found to be at fault and have to pay out money for damages. This includes damages for medical bills as well as property damage, suffering and pain.
Most states have modified comparative fault laws, which determine a driver's compensation based on the proportion of the fault for an accident. In certain states, like New York, the 50 bar rule applies, meaning that drivers who are found to be more than 50% at fault for an accident cannot seek damages from their insurers.
When it comes to determining fault in a car accident can be a challenge, there are a few things that you should do to ensure that you don't create any problems for yourself or undermine your efforts to get the full amount of compensation. First take the time to breathe deeply and focus on the health and safety of both yourself and others. Next, collect as the evidence you can, including pictures of the scene, names, and contact information for witnesses.
Insurance Claims
Insurance claims are a crucial part of car accident law, as they allow injured victims to collect the cost of their medical treatment and property damage. They also offer compensation for pain and suffering to victims who are suffering from emotional and psychological trauma as a direct result of the collision.
One of the most crucial steps to pursue an insurance claim is to file it as fast as you can. In the event of a delay, it can alter the outcome of your claim, and can lead to an investigation, which can be costly and time-consuming.
Additionally, it is important to have all the required documents and evidence on hand to back up your claim. This includes medical records, reports, photos of the scene, and witness statements.
It is important to find the contact information of the other driver and insurance information as well. This will help you file claims for the insurance coverage of the other driver. It can also assist in determining who is responsible for the accident.
Many insurers offer an insurance checklist available on their mobile applications or printed form that lists the most important information to include when filing an insurance claim. This could include the name of the driver who was not insured, insurance company and policy number, license plates as well as any damage that may have been done to your vehicle; as well as any witnesses.
Additionally, it is essential to take pictures of the scene of the accident and also get the name of the driver who caused the accident as well as his phone number. These images can be shared with your lawyer and insurance company to ensure that they have all of the information necessary to process your claim.
Another important aspect of insurance claims is to be truthful about your injuries and the damages. Although it may be tempting to dismiss your injuries or accidents, this could impact your chances of winning in a court case.
You should also keep records of your current and future medical bills as well as any associated costs, like lost wages. These records can also help you calculate the value of your claim and when negotiating with an insurance company.
While it's not required by law, some states offer insurance for cars that will cover medical treatment for the victim of a car accident regardless of who is at fault. This insurance is known as "no fault" coverage. While this type limits the possibility of seeking compensation from other drivers, it is a good option for some people.
Filing a Lawsuit
If you're injured in a car crash which wasn't your fault, you could be entitled to compensation for medical bills, lost income and other damages. This could be a problem if the insurance company of the other driver refuses to pay.
In these situations you could decide to sue the other driver. The process of suing can take up to several years depending on the state where the crash took place.
Your lawyer will need to have access to your medical records as well as other documents before he files the case. This will allow the lawyer to understand the extent and severity of your injuries. Your attorney will also need information about the accident and the witnesses, such as speaking with them and studying police reports.
Once your lawyer has collected all the evidence required and evidence, they will meet with you to discuss the case and decide on the best route for the future. This could involve negotiations with the insurance company of the other party, or filing a civil lawsuit.
If you have a strong case the two sides will attempt to settle the matter prior to trial. This will save time and money on legal fees. It also can reduce the stress of litigation.
A lawyer will look over the specifics of your case, and provide recommendations for a strategy that will get you the most compensation you can get. This could involve obtaining expert testimony, such doctors or economists to back up your claim.
If you've got a strong case, your lawyer will negotiate with the insurance company of the other driver company for an equitable settlement. Your lawyer can file a lawsuit if there is a significant disagreement over the amount of compensation you should receive or who was responsible for the crash.
Legal proceedings can be complicated, and you should always consult a professional personal injury attorney prior to starting one. It is crucial to remember that even if you have a strong case, it will take lots of time and effort from you to be successful.
